Bio

Lalo’s love for music spans the diversity of two continents. Born in a Toronto housing project to Salvadorean parents his introduction to music came at an early age on the one hand from songs of protest from Latin America that spoke openly against the injustice of poverty, and on the other from the music of Hip Hop. It wasn’t long before he started making some connections between the songs of protest from Latin America and the poverty, and discrimination that marked his and his families’s lives.His older brother shared similar ambitions and began to DJ. Lalo was 12 when he would DJ along side his older brother at many house parties and clubs. Hip hop became his vehicle for confronting his reality by making music that brought his experience to the forefront and spoke of change, and the possibility of a creating a better future. At the age of 15 he wrote his 1st song. With a style purely of his own Lalo credits greats like Nas, KRS-ONE, 2Pac, and Gang starr for influencing him, and nurturing his talent. Now 21 years old, Lalo has performed all over from lounges in downtown toronto to the Annual Poetry Festivile in Kingston Ontario. He is now part of STEP UP a rising community oriented poetry group in toronto and will be releasing his debute album in summer 2007.
